Eight Allies,Including Bulgaria, Join Forces in Romania for Exercise SCORPIONS FURY 18

Around 1,800 troops from NATO Allies Bulgaria, Canada, Hungary, Italy, Poland, Portugal, Romania and Spain are taking part in the Romania-led exercise SCORPIONS FURY 18 from 5 to 16 November.

This will include computer-assisted training, live-firings and other field training exercises at the Joint National Training Centre in Cincu, Romania.
